BasketbAcross NSW
The Wheelchair Basketball program at BasketbAcross NSW is a program for people with or without physical limitations. This program is for males under 23 years and females under 25 years.
-

Riding for the Disabled Association (NSW)
RDA provides assisted riding activities for people with a disability, aimed to develop and enhance their abilities. Children aged 3+ years can participate in their activities.
